The exterior angles of a regular polygon sum
360 degrees
The exterior angles are calculated by the formula
360/n
The sum of the interior angles is calculated by the formula
180(n-2)
Interior angle + exterior angle =
180 degrees
Cyclic Quadrilateral
A quadrilateral whose vertices all lie on a single circle.
Cramer's Rule
Method for solving systems of linear equations using determinants.
